Boneless Chicken Filling
#weekmulticolour
This filling can be a fabulous idea for many an important Snacks and Brunch options. Here in this, I have used Chicken cubes. The spices can be altered according to one's own preference. A multipurpose filling or stuffing that can be prepared and stored for more than four days if kept in the freezer. And can be kept for a day or two in the Chill tray section in the refrigerator in an airtight container.
Nevertheless it's done quickly, but sometimes, like as in the Month of Ramadan, it becomes handy to use whenever required. It's like a boon. Especially for large families or close knit families where we need to cook on a large scale. I have already shared Chicken Matar Kheema also which is a lovely option for filling.

Steps
- 1
Heat Oil and saute Onions until light golden in colour on a low heat. Also add Garlic and Ginger both along with chopped Spring Onions. Now add Chicken cubes. Saute until the raw smell fades away.
- 2
Along with it add the other Veggies and the ingredients mentioned. Saute all on a medium high heat until crisp and done. Squeeze some Lemon juice on top. Adjust Salt at this stage and garnish with lots of chopped Coriander Leaves.
- 3
Stir fry all of that on a low to medium high heat. Cover for a couple of minutes if required. Otherwise there is no need at all. As it is actually a stir fry, it's better to keep stirring and have a vigilant eye on it. If not, the Veggies might leave water and the whole texture will be spoilt. So always keep that in mind.
- 4
Use it as a filling in Samosas, Kachoris, Momos, Non-Veg Patties, Sandwiches, Frankies and Rolls. The choices are pretty much endless. Enjoy!
